Abstract Malta has been at the forefront in aging policy and healthy aging development. It was the first country to highlight the need of a United Nations-led international action plan aimed at meeting the needs of an emerging global aging population. Through a number of initiatives, Malta has managed to put aging as a top priority on its national policy agenda. The country boasts of the longest life span spent in good health among all European Union countries with its inhabitants expected to live a significant portion of their life free of disability. Malta’s ranking in the Active Ageing Index experienced consistent improvements in the past decade, registering the sharpest progress in the European Union. In response to an increase in individuals with dementia, Malta was also among the first countries to adopt a national strategic policy for dementia. Notwithstanding such significant progress, Malta still lags behind in developing policy directions addressing gender inequalities and minority groups’ interests among its older population. Similar to other Southern European countries, Malta’s accelerated rate of population aging raises concerns with regard to economic growth, sustainability of effective health care and pension systems, and the well-being of older persons. Gender will also feature prominently in the future planning of long-term care policy as older women are projected to increase threefold in the foreseeable years with the high risk of poverty associated with older single and widowed women, implying that a few would be able to opt for private care.

Food plays an essential role in performance and well-being. Apart from its physiological necessity, food is also a source of pleasure. Since both biological needs for food and psychic satisfaction from food vary considerably among and within populations, coming up with precise, operationalizable measures of food security have proved problematic. Furthermore, the concept of food security encompasses not only current nutritional status but also vulnerability to future disruptions in one’s access to adequate and appropriate food. The complexity of the concept of food security has given rise to scores, if not hundreds, of different definitions of the term “food security.” As a result, there have also been variations in thinking about the proximate manifestations and direct and indirect causes and consequences of “food insecurity,” the complement to “food security.” Food security is commonly conceptualized as resting on three pillars that are inherently hierarchical: availability, access, and utilization. Some agencies, such as the United Nations Food and Agriculture Organization (FAO), have added a fourth dimension: stability. Food insecurity is often used interchangeably with the terms “hunger,” “undernutrition,” and “malnutrition.” Threats to food insecurity may be classified as either “covariate” or “idiosyncratic.” Based on these threats, various interventions have been implemented to promote food security by means of increasing availability (improving agricultural productivity), promoting access (economic growth and assistance programs such as food stamps or vouchers, food aid delivery, food banks, school lunch programs), or improving utilization (supplementary feeding programs, therapeutic feeding programs).

The aim of this study was to analyze the factors that can influence pork prices, particularly the effects of various types of fluctuations on the volatility of pork prices in the European Union as a whole market and individual EU countries. The research material consisted of monthly time series of pork prices collected from 2009 to 2020. These data originated from the Integrated System of Agricultural Information coordinated by the Polish Ministry of Agriculture. Information on global pork production volumes is from the Food and Agriculture Organization Statistics (FAOSTAT) database. Time series of prices were described by the multiplicative model, and seasonal breakdown was performed using the Census X-11 method. The separation of the cyclical component of the trend was performed using the Hodrick–Prescott filter. In 2019, pork production in the European Union totaled 23,954 thousand tonnes, which accounted for 21.8% of global pork production. The largest producers were Germany, Spain, and France, supplying more than half of the pork to the entire European Union market. Pork prices in the EU, averaged over the 2009–2020 period were Euro (EUR) 154.63/100 kg. The highest prices for pork were recorded in Malta, Cyprus, Bulgaria, and Greece, whereas the lowest prices in Belgium, the Netherlands, Denmark, and France. The breakdown of the time series for pork prices confirmed that, in the period from 2009 to 2020, pork prices exhibited considerable fluctuations of both a long-term and medium-term nature as well as short-term seasonal and irregular fluctuations. Prices were higher than average in summer (with a peak in June–August) and lower in winter (January–March). Overall, the proportions of different types of changes in pork prices were as follows: random changes—7.9%, seasonal changes—36.6%, and cyclical changes—55.5%.

The article presents an assessment of changes that have occurred in the production, consumption and trade of oilseeds and their processing products in the European Union in the years 2000-2013. The analysis of changes was carried out for 28 EU countries, including the division into old and new Member States, based on available data from the Food and Agriculture Organization of the United Nations (FAOSTAT). Since the beginning of the 21st century, the production and consumption of oilseeds in the European Union has been dynamically increasing following the rapidly growing demand for vegetable oils in the industrial sector (in biofuel production), with small changes in the food sector and rapidly growing demand for oilmeals in the feed sector, due to the development of livestock production (mainly poultry production) and a change in animal feeding technology. Despite the dynamic development of oilseed production and processing (faster in the new Member States than the old), the European Union has low self-sufficiency in the field of oil products and remains a permanent importer of oilseeds (including especially oilmeals).
